THE BEGINNING
J'Wan began singing at the age of 3, and writing songs and poetry at the age of 5. By her teens she was performing around the DMV with all-girl bands Diamond is Forever, Genuine, and Royalty. After having her daughter Jessica, she took time away from music to concentrate on being a mom. But not happy with the 9 to 5 scene, she formed JYMstone Entertainment in 2004 with her cousins Zsa Zsa, Amber, Tara and Rickia.
